Chinaunix

标题: [求助]rpm包提示已经安装,但删除的时候又提示没有安装,困惑……[已解决] [打印本页]

作者: 三楼的楼长    时间: 2008-11-12 11:20
标题: [求助]rpm包提示已经安装,但删除的时候又提示没有安装,困惑……[已解决]
在CentOS 5.2上安装MySQL几个包:

MySQL-devel-community-5.0.67-0.rhel5.i386.rpm
MySQL-server-community-5.0.67-0.rhel5.i386.rpm
MySQL-shared-community-5.0.67-0.rhel5.i386.rpm

#rpm -ivh MySQL-devel-community-5.0.67-0.rhel5.i386.rpm
Preparing...                ########################################### [100%]
        package MySQL-devel-community-5.0.67-0.rhel5 is already installed

其他2个包也是一样,都提示already installed.

但是删除的时候遇到问题:
# rpm -e MySQL-devel-community-5.0.67-0.rhel5.i386.rpm
error: package MySQL-devel-community-5.0.67-0.rhel5.i386.rpm is not installed

又变成没有安装了!!??
其他2个包也是同样。

已经 --rebuilddb过rpm包数据库,还是不行,求助!!!  

[ 本帖最后由 三楼的楼长 于 2008-11-12 11:28 编辑 ]
作者: siseniao    时间: 2008-11-12 11:24
先用 rpm -qa|grep MySQL-devel 查一下,然后再用rpm -e 加上查到的软件包名不就行了吗
作者: 三楼的楼长    时间: 2008-11-12 11:28
原帖由 siseniao 于 2008-11-12 11:24 发表
先用 rpm -qa|grep MySQL-devel 查一下,然后再用rpm -e 加上查到的软件包名不就行了吗



喔,确实是行了,装上后的包名少了.i386,原因在这里。

谢谢




欢迎光临 Chinaunix (http://bbs.chinaunix.net/) Powered by Discuz! X3.2